Dominant Red Bull face championship crisis

Kuala Lumpur:  Red Bull faced a pivotal moment on Monday in their push for a fourth straight double world title, with the team in crisis after Sebastian Vettel defied strict orders at the Malaysian Grand Prix.Team principal Christian Horner admitted the British-based outfit would have to go through difficult discussions after Vettel's late overtaking manoeuvre incensed stablemate Mark Webber and left him considering his future.As Webber, robbed of victory by Vettel's late pass, flew back to Australia for a surfing break, and Vettel headed in the other direction to Europe, the team's deep divisions recalled the tensions of some of the sport's great internal rivalries.With Webber...
